Stephanie Mavunga Selected For U.S. Pan Am Women's Basketball Team


North Carolina sophomore forward will play on the 2015 U.S. Pan American Women’s Basketball Team, USA Basketball announced Sunday. Mavunga previously competed on the USA Women’s U16 National Team in 2011, helping to bring home the gold medal. The 12-member team was chosen after three days of trials with 51 total college athletes vying for a spot. (GoHeels.com)
